Million Dollar Pound Cake Recipe

This Million Dollar Pound Cake is a rich, buttery classic dessert made with a combination of vanilla and almond extracts for a unique, aromatic flavor. Baked low and slow in an angel food pan, this pound cake boasts a dense yet tender crumb, perfect for serving at celebrations or as an indulgent everyday treat.

Ingredients

Scale

Dry Ingredients

  • 4 cups all-purpose flour (sifted)
  • 3 cups granulated sugar

Wet Ingredients

  • 1 pound salted butter (softened, 4 sticks)
  • 6 large eggs
  • 3/4 cup whole milk OR buttermilk
  • 1 Tbsp pure v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on almond extract

Instructions

  1. Preheat and Prepare Pan: Preheat your oven to 300°F. Butter and flour an angel food pan (tube pan) with a removable bottom, or alternatively, spray it with baking spray. Set the prepared pan aside while you prepare the batter.
  2. Whip Butter and Extracts: In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the whisk attachment, whip together the softened butter, vanilla extract, and almond extract on medium-high speed for about 5 minutes until the mixture is light and fluffy.
  3. Add Sugar Gradually: Switch to the paddle attachment and gradually add the granulated sugar, beating on medium speed. Continue beating for around 5 minutes until the mixture turns a light yellow color, indicating ample aeration.
  4. Incorporate Eggs: Add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ition to ensure full incorporation. Scrape down the sides of the bowl with a spatula as needed to mix everything evenly.
  5. Add Flour and Milk Alternately: Lower the mixer speed and add the sifted flour alternately with the milk, starting and ending with the flour. Pause occasionally to scrape the sides of the bowl to maintain an even mixture.
  6. Final Mix: Once all ingredients have been added, beat the batter for an additional 1 minute to fully incorporate the flour without overmixing.
  7. Transfer Batter to Pan: Spread the batter evenly in the prepared angel food pan. Gently bounce the pan on the counter to settle the batter and remove air bubbles.
  8. Bake the Cake: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ake for 1 hour and 30-45 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. This ensures the cake is fully baked without being dry.
  9. Initial Cooling: Remove the cake from the oven and let it cool for 15 minutes. Then carefully remove the outer ring of the pan.
  10. Cool Completely: Transfer the cake to a wire rack and allow it to cool completely before serving to ensure the best texture and slicing quality.

Notes

  • Using buttermilk will add a slight tang and tender crumb, but whole milk works well too.
  • Ensure the butter is fully softened to allow proper whipping and aeration.
  • Sifting the flour prevents lumps and ensures a smooth batter.
  • Baking at a low temperature prevents the cake from drying out and promotes even baking.
  • Cooling the cake in the pan before removing the ring helps maintain its shape.
